I see you will be working on a film? That sounds like fun! I remember when my brother's best friend, who was a film student at UCLA, was shooting his final project at our house. This was years ago, in the late 1980s. I did not participate, but it was fun to watch. He, too, only had a limited amount of time to complete his film (though in your case it is by design, for sponteneity), and he and his student crew and actors (about 7 people in all) pretty much worked from sunup until sundown to get it done, over a Memorial Day weekend. It was a Vampire epic, and one of the locations they used was the old Norwegian Church in my photograph. They had an old 16mm camera (Arriflex, maybe), and my brother did the sound. I think it was one of his first experiences with sound equipment, and of course he went on to be a sound engineer (re-recording mixer).
